Transaction 33904aa49fc584c270c55f47ced7404bc93fe8babf06792f2bbae3a20f818fa5
3 Input
1 Outputs
- 33904aa49fc584c270c55f47ced7404bc93fe8babf06792f2bbae3a20f818fa5:0
value 868329
address 1G5YMWgDVj1ekteWDVMZx5j4AjAbJs6d8K